VMware,作为全球领先的虚拟化解决方案提供商,其产品在提高资源利用率、简化运维管理、促进业务灵活性等方面发挥着至关重要的作用
其中,VMware的双网卡端口组功能更是为构建高效、可靠的虚拟网络环境奠定了坚实的基础
本文将深入探讨VMware双网卡端口组的原理、配置方法、优势及其在实际应用中的价值,旨在帮助读者更好地理解和应用这一技术
一、VMware双网卡端口组概述 VMware ESXi服务器作为虚拟化环境的基石,通过虚拟化层将物理硬件资源抽象为虚拟资源,供虚拟机(VM)使用
在网络层面,VMware通过虚拟交换机(vSwitch)实现虚拟机与物理网络之间的连接
vSwitch模拟了传统物理交换机的功能,允许虚拟机之间以及虚拟机与外部网络的高效通信
而双网卡端口组,则是vSwitch上一个重要的配置选项,它允许将两个或多个物理网卡(NICs)绑定到一个逻辑端口组上,以实现网络流量的负载均衡、故障转移和高可用性
二、双网卡端口组的配置原理 1.负载均衡(Load Balancing):在双网卡端口组中,可以根据配置策略(如基于源MAC地址、目标MAC地址、源IP地址、目标IP地址等)将网络流量分散到多个物理网卡上,从而优化网络性能,减少单个网卡的负担,提高整体吞吐量
2.故障转移(Failover):当其中一个物理网卡发生故障时,双网卡端口组能够自动将流量转移到其他正常工作的网卡上,确保网络连接的连续性,减少因单点故障导致的服务中断时间
3.网络冗余(Redundancy):通过双网卡端口组的配置,实现了网络路径的多样性,增强了网络的稳定性和可靠性
即使某一网络路径出现问题,也能迅速切换到备用路径,保证业务的连续运行
三、配置步骤与实践 配置VMware双网卡端口组通常涉及以下几个步骤: 1.识别物理网卡:首先,在ESXi主机上识别并确认将要用于双网卡端口组的物理网卡
2.创建vSwitch:在vSphere Client或ESXi主机管理界面中,创建一个新的vSwitch或选择一个现有的vSwitch作为配置基础
3.添加物理网卡到vSwitch:将选定的物理网卡添加到vSwitch的上行链路(Uplink)中
对于双网卡端口组,需要至少添加两个物理网卡
4.配置端口组:在vSwitch下创建一个新的虚拟机端口组(VM Port Group),并在其设置中启用“网络负载均衡”和“故障转移”功能
根据实际需求,选择适当的负载均衡策略和故障转移顺序
5.分配虚拟机到端口组:将需要利用双网卡端口组功能的虚拟机网络接口连接到之前创建的端口组上
6.验证配置:最后,通过监控工具和实际网络测试验证双网卡端口组的配置是否生效,确保负载均衡和故障转移功能正常工作
四、双网卡端口组的优势 1.提升网络性能:通过负载均衡机制,双网卡端口组能够有效分散网络流量,充分利用物理网卡带宽,提高数据传输速率,降低延迟
2.增强网络可靠性:故障转移功能确保在物理网卡故障时,网络流量能够无缝切换至备用网卡,减少服务中断风险,提升系统稳定性
3.简化管理:VMware的双网卡端口组配置灵活,管理便捷,通过vSphere管理平台即可轻松完成配置和调整,降低了运维复杂度
4.成本效益:通过提高硬件资源的利用率和减少因网络故障导致的业务损失,双网卡端口组为企业带来了显著的成本节约效益
5.支持高级特性:双网卡端口组还支持诸如链路聚合(Link Aggregation)、虚拟机移动性(VMotion)等高级功能,进一步增强了虚拟化环境的灵活性和可扩展性
五、实际应用案例 以某大型数据中心为例,该中心部署了数百台VMware ESXi服务器,承载了包括数据库、Web应用、存储服务在内的多种关键业务
为了确保这些业务的高可用性和高性能,数据中心采用了双网卡端口组配置
通过负载均衡,有效分散了服务器间的网络流量,避免了网络瓶颈;同时,通过故障转移机制,即使某个物理网卡出现故障,也能迅速切换至备用网卡,确保了业务的连续运行
此外,结合VMware的VMotion技术,数据中心还实现了虚拟机在不同服务器之间的动态迁移,进一步提升了资源的灵活性和业务的连续性
六、结论 综上所述,VMware双网卡端口组作为虚拟化网络环境的重要组成部分,通过其负载均衡、故障转移和网络冗余等特性,为构建高效、可靠的虚拟网络环境提供了强有力的支持
无论是从提升网络性能、增强系统稳定性,还是从简化管理、降低成本的角度来看,双网卡端口组都展现出了不可替代的价值
随着虚拟化技术的不断发展和普及,掌握并合理应用这一技术,对于提升企业的IT运维效率、保障业务连续性具有重要意义
未来,随着技术的持续演进,我们有理由相信,VMware双网卡端口组将在更多场景中发挥其独特优势,为企业数字化转型之路保驾护航